TravelCenters to Offer Free Meals on Veterans Day

WESTLAKE, Ohio -- TravelCenters of America LLC, operator of TA and Petro Stopping Centers truck stops, is offering a complimentary meal to any truck driver who is also a veteran of the U.S. Armed Forces.

On Veterans Day, Monday, Nov. 11, anyone who is a U.S. veteran and holds a commercial driver’s license can receive a complimentary meal of their choice, up to a $15 value, at any participating TA or Petro sit-down restaurant across the United States. More than 170 restaurants are participating, including Iron Skillet, Country Pride and other full-service, homestyle restaurants, according to the company.

"Professional drivers who are veterans have spent their life sacrificing personal and family time both in the armed forces and every day on the road," said Tom O’Brien, president and CEO of TravelCenters. "We want to take this opportunity to recognize them for these sacrifices and the contributions they have made to our country while in the service and to each of us by moving all of the products we use and need."

To receive their free meal, drivers need only to show proof of their service to the server prior to ordering their meal. Proof of service includes a U.S. Uniform Services Retired identification card, Veterans Organization card, photograph in uniform, DD214, citation or commendation.

Westlake, Ohio-based TravelCenters of America operates 247 TA and Petro Stopping Center locations in 42 states and Canada.
